Commercial films today often reduce representations of natural catastrophes to commodified spectacles that de-contextualize the subject matter. To contemporary film viewers, the ‘psychic numbing’ effect is apparent, and it does not apply merely to our perception of numbers, statistics, the big data. It can also be seen when we are bombarded with similar kinds of images over and over again; in this case, the large-scale tsunami, the hurricanes, the earthquake and all the exaggerated destruction scenes in recent disaster movies have become clichés no matter how realistic and intense the shots are made. By focusing on a range of eco-disaster films, this article highlights the importance of cultural sensitivity in the study of eco-disaster films, by exploring several questions: how are eco-disasters culturally shaped and defined, via cinematic means? How are human responses to disasters, as reflected in cinematic representations, shaped by specific sociopolitical, cultural or economic conditions? How does cinema as a media form represent ecological concepts that are shared globally or universally, while at the same time reflecting specific cultural characteristics? Juxtaposing examples from China, Thailand and the Phillippines, particularly with three films: Wonderful Town (Thailand, 2007), Aftershock (China, 2010) and Taklub (Phillippines, 2015), this article demonstrates how Asian eco-disaster films in the Anthropocene epoch reflect specific cultural imaginations of nation and identity rebuilding, which in turn provide a ground to reposition, redefine and reinvent the changing cultural identities in contemporary Asia. Eventually, it argues that eco-disaster narratives in Asia reflect the identity crisis of Asian nations in a global capitalist world, just as much as they are about ecological crises.

Across human history, many cultures have produced different ‘centres of the world’, with cartography often being bound up in the construction and representations of this axis mundi. A contemporary manifestation of these ancient phenomena can be seen in Google Maps, the most popular world-map ever made. Google use surveillance to present various types of customized centres-of-the-world, with their global representation being automatically tailored for specific subjects. This study uses engaged theory to analytically separate the levels of abstraction inherent in these processes, connecting empiric observations with large-scale historic transformations, with a focus on subjective and material changes in relation to the capitalist world-system. It is argued that the automated, atomizing processes bound up in Google Maps serve to projects intensifying abstractions into everyday social practice, thus reconstituting how space and time are experienced, as well as being intimately bound up with intensifying processes of capital accumulation and social control.

<p>Damages from flooding in China account on average for 60-70% of the total Annual Losses derived from natural catastrophes. The extreme rainfall events responsible for these inundations can be broadly categorised in two well differentiated mechanisms: Tropical Cyclone (TC) induced, and non Tropical Cyclone induced (nonTC) precipitation. Between 2001 and 2015, inland nonTC rainfall flood events occurred roughly with double the frequency as TC events. While TC events can be highly destructive for coastal locations, over the entire China territory nonTC flooding accounted for more than half of the total economic flood loss for events with significant socio-economic impact, highlighting the importance of the nonTC flooding mechanism on the regional and national scale.</p><p>Large-scale modes of climate variability modulate in different ways TC and nonTC induced precipitation, both in the frequency and the magnitude of the events. In a stochastic rainfall generation framework, it becomes therefore useful to model these two mechanisms separately and include their differentiated long-term climatic influences in order to fully reproduce the overall observed rainfall variability. This work presents results on the effect of ENSO and Southern Oscillation Index (SOI) values on seasonal rainfall in China, and how to include this climatic variability in stochastic rainfall for flood catastrophe modelling.</p>

AbstractThis article examines a 1956 United Nations effort to respond to decolonization, by supplying newly independent governments with international administrators to help build sovereign nation-states out of the disintegrating European empires and anchor them firmly within the capitalist world. The article reveals the UN as a significant historical actor during the Cold War beyond the organization’s function of providing a forum for intergovernmental debates and lobbying. While the initiative never resulted in a large-scale response to decolonization, it ultimately effected a substantial shift in the practice of development assistance: from advisory services to a more paternalist approach that focused on ‘getting the work done’ on behalf of aid recipients. Recovering this history helps account for the strange triumph of state sovereignty in the second half of the twentieth century: its global proliferation at a time when international actors became increasingly active in the management of the public affairs of developing countries.

The paper discusses an intermediary phase in Franco Moretti’s intellectual journey, namely the years 1990s. This is a period of transition in Moretti’s thinking, in which he is working simultaneously on two fronts: on the one hand, he is refining evermore and bringing to completion his specific brand of close reading analysis developed in the previous decade – namely the combination of evolutionary theory, formal-rhetorical analysis, and eclectic Marxism (with its highly unstable mix of Lukács, Wallerstein, and Della Volpe); on the other, he is forging for the first time the new tools and concepts of what will become, after 2000, his defining intellectual signature – the method of distant reading. The two undertakings correspond to two opposed literary objects: on the one hand, the novel – with its regularity of form, reproduction in large scale, centripetal movement, bourgeois imaginary, and national horizon; on the other, what we call the ‘anti-novel’, which is the modern epic in Moretti’s understanding – the few dozen ‘world-texts’, highly polymorphous and reproducible only in few and select occurrences, centrifugal in their movement, and transcending the national and bourgeois horizon, rooted as they are in the critical, semi-peripheral junctures of the capitalist world-system. The paper dwells on some of the oppositions and similarities, overlaps and contradictions, theoretical problems and practical solutions, raised or offered by the two methodological approaches and their corresponding literary objects.

The most fruitful approaches to the study of slave resistance in the New World have involved examination of the slaves' struggles to create and control institutions of community and kinship in the face of planters' attempts to suppress local social reproduction altogether. Africanists who would attempt similar analysis of rebellious slave consciousness are hampered by the tradition of functionalist anthropology which dominates studies of African culture, especially Miers and Kopytoff's thesis of the integrative nature of African slavery. By contrast, more class-oriented approaches to studies of African slave resistance assume too stark a division between the consciousness of slaves and the consciousness of masters. It is suggested that Gramsci's concepts of hegemony and contradictory popular consciousness can be used to reconcile the cultural sensitivity of the first approach with the concern of the second for issues of domination and struggle. Thus a more nuanced view of slave consciousness might be reached.The case studied involves resistance to the rapid rise of sugar plantations on the northern Tanzania coast in the late nineteenth century. Miers and Kopytoff's model of the ‘reduction of marginality’ is modified to accommodate a process of conflict, as slaves struggled to gain access to institutions of Swahili prestige and citizenship and as their masters struggled to exclude them. Analysis of a large-scale slave rebellion in 1873 reveals that the consciousness of the rebels was couched in the local ‘traditional’ language of a moral economy of patrons and clients. Although this language was expressive of some of the hegemonic ideas of the emergent planter class, it was also openly rebellious. It expressed neither a slave class-consciousness nor simply the ideology of the dominant planter class but was instead a contradictory consciousness of the type that Gramsci discerned in other movements of agrarian rebellion.

AbstractUnusual short-period comet 29P/Schwassmann-Wachmann 1 inspired many observers to explain its unpredictable outbursts. In this paper large scale structures and features from the inner part of the coma in time periods around outbursts are studied. CCD images were taken at Whipple Observatory, Mt. Hopkins, in 1989 and at Astronomical Observatory, Modra, from 1995 to 1998. Photographic plates of the comet were taken at Harvard College Observatory, Oak Ridge, from 1974 to 1982. The latter were digitized at first to apply the same techniques of image processing for optimizing the visibility of features in the coma during outbursts. Outbursts and coma structures show various shapes.

AbstractThe large-scale coronal structures observed during the sporadically visible solar eclipses were compared with the numerically extrapolated field-line structures of coronal magnetic field. A characteristic relationship between the observed structures of coronal plasma and the magnetic field line configurations was determined. The long-term evolution of large scale coronal structures inferred from photospheric magnetic observations in the course of 11- and 22-year solar cycles is described.Some known parameters, such as the source surface radius, or coronal rotation rate are discussed and actually interpreted. A relation between the large-scale photospheric magnetic field evolution and the coronal structure rearrangement is demonstrated.

AbstractPrecise measurements of heliographic position of solar filaments were used for determination of the proper motion of solar filaments on the time-scale of days. The filaments have a tendency to make a shaking or waving of the external structure and to make a general movement of whole filament body, coinciding with the transport of the magnetic flux in the photosphere. The velocity scatter of individual measured points is about one order higher than the accuracy of measurements.

Trends in the technology development of very large scale integrated circuits (VLSI) have been in the direction of higher density of components with smaller dimensions. The scaling down of device dimensions has been not only laterally but also in depth. Such efforts in miniaturization bring with them new developments in materials and processing. Successful implementation of these efforts is, to a large extent, dependent on the proper understanding of the material properties, process technologies and reliability issues, through adequate analytical studies. The analytical instrumentation technology has, fortunately, kept pace with the basic requirements of devices with lateral dimensions in the micron/ submicron range and depths of the order of nonometers. Often, newer analytical techniques have emerged or the more conventional techniques have been adapted to meet the more stringent requirements. As such, a variety of analytical techniques are available today to aid an analyst in the efforts of VLSI process evaluation. Generally such analytical efforts are divided into the characterization of materials, evaluation of processing steps and the analysis of failures.
